    Instructions
    Because the template is your choice, the only way I will know if you participated is if you link your layout in this thread or within the SwL Group Facebook Album. To qualify, post your layout to the gallery or hosting site of your choice* and then paste the image and link here by 8:15 pm ET tonight to qualify for the drawing and by 7:00 pm ET tomorrow (05 APR 2020) to qualify for the free template. You can make your layout yours; add items and design as you like, as long as, you follow the instructions below. Don't forget to shadow.

    Theme: The Eye Test "Which is Better, 1 or 2?"
    There are two layout samples, each instruction will have a choice - a choice between Sample 1 and Sample 2. For each instruction, pick which you like better and scrap it! You can have a mix of Sample 1 and Sample 2; meaning you don't have to stay with the same layout for all five instructions.

    NOTE: THE INFO IN () IS FOR REFERENCE ONLY AND IS NOT INSTRUCTIONS - BASICALLY FOR EACH INSTRUCTION CHOOSE EITHER BLUE OR PINK

    1. Have two photos-all layouts, for those two pictures either have them S1: contain a single subject that is non-human (a dog) OR S2: contain multiple subjects all human (a crowd waiting in line).

    2. For the two photos, S1: mat them on a common mat (newspaper mat) OR S2: place a frame around them (yellow dot postage frame).

    3. For the background papers have S1: two large pattern papers stacked with a narrow border showing of the bottom paper all around the page (green horizontal stripe on top of dog paw bowl squares) OR S2: have multiple patterned papers peeking in from both the top and bottom of the page with a solid paper background (pink pattern, purple pattern and multiple color circles on top of gray-white background).

    4. Have a single fleece/felt flower-all layouts, for that flower make it S1: a neutral color (gray) OR S2: a bright color (turquoise/teal).

    5. Button it up or not, S1: have a button on the side of one of the photos (light blue with bow) OR S2: do not use any buttons.

    INSTRUCTIONS (alternative format if you find the above confusing)
    Pick either A or B for each instruction...

    1A. Have two photos, those photos should contain a single subject that is non-human.
    1B. Have two photos, those photos should contain multiple subjects all human.

    2A. For the two photos, mat them on a common mat.
    2B. For the two photos, place a frame around them.

    3A. For the background papers have two large pattern papers stacked with a narrow border showing of the bottom paper all around the page.
    3B. For the background papers have have multiple patterned papers peeking in from both the top and bottom of the page with a solid paper background.

    4A. Have a single fleece/felt flower in a neutral color.
    4B. Have a single fleece/felt flower in a bright color.

    5A. Have a button on the side of one of the photos.
    5B. Do not use any buttons.
